Samsung’s 5 Megapixel Mobile Phone Launched

Samsung’s flagship model SGH U900 is finally launched in Indian market. Along with the Samsung’s best model 8 other mobile phones and mobile accessories where launched. Sunil Dutt, Country Head, Samsung India while announcing the launch said: “These phones target today’s style-conscious consumers, looking for a perfect blend of outstanding quality, design and performance. We are confident that that these will enhance the Samsung consumer experience in the premium phone category.”
The key feature of Samsung U900 is the “Magic Touch by DaCP”. According to the user’s need Magic Touch changes the navigation indicator on the keypad. This could be better explained with the help of an example: in case of music mode on the navigation indicator music related icons will light-up. In the same way in camera mode related icons like brightness and zoom icon will appear.
Though the phone is 12.9mm thin but it is equipped with specialized photographic functions including a 5 megapixel camera. Other unique features of Samsung U900 are listed below:
- Face detection
- Wide Dynamic Range (WDR)
- Image stabilizer
- 7.2 Mpbs HSDPA
The phone also features digital power amplifier by ICE power technology and music library navigation which is a feast for music lovers. And due to the presence of 7.2 Mpbs HSDPA songs can be downloaded at a higher speed. Samsung U900 is priced around Rs.20,585.
